The century of the self is a thought provoking, four part documentary describing how freudian and postfreudian ideas about human nature were adopted by corporations and politicians to manipulate society and public values in the 20th century.

Bernays invented the public relations profession in the 1920s and was the first person to take freuds ideas to manipulate the masses. Part three addresses how the concepts established by bernuys were reassessed during the 1960s, and led to the creation of the me generation in the usa. The century of the allconsuming self happiness machines the century of the self is a united kingdom documentary film by adam curtis first screened on bbc television in 2002 in four parts.
